nv show system health

Show system health status.

Syntax Description

N/A

Default

N/A

History

25.02.2002

Example

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health operational applied ---------- ----------- ------- status Not OK status-led off       Health issues ================ Component Status information --------- ------------------ LEAKAGE-1 detected leakage

REST API

GET https://<ip>/nvue_v1/system/health

nv show system health history [file-name]

Show system health history file.

Syntax Description

file-name

Show health history files in the system

History

25.02.2002

Example

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health history

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health history files   health history reports      File path ----------------------       ------------------------- health_history                 /var/log/health_history health_history.1              /var/log/health_history.1

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health history files health_history

REST API

GET https://<ip>/nvue_v1/system/health/history

Related Commands

nv show system health

Notes

  • When running the command via the CLI, the file open in “Less”

  • When no file is selected, the default file name that opens is “health_history”

nv show system health component

Display system components health.

Syntax Description

N/A

Default

N/A

History

25.02.7002

Example

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health component   Component           State            Last Unhealthy              Unhealthy Count ---------------     ------------     --------------------------    ------------------- Fan                 HEALTHY          2025-01-01 18:00:10      2 ASIC                UNHEALTHY     2025-01-01 19:00:10      1 CPU                 UNHEALTHY      2025-01-01 18:00:10      1 Transceiver         UNSPECIFIED                                    0 Switch              HEALTHY          2025-01-01 20:00:10      1 Leakage-sensor    HEALTHY                                        0 Software            HEALTHY                                        0

REST API

GET https://<ip>/nvue_v1/system/health/component

nv show system health component {component-id}

Display system component health for a specific componenet.

Syntax Description

component-id

Component name (e.g., PSU, Fan, Software)

Default

N/A

History

25.02.7002

Example

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v show system health component Fan   -------------------------   ------------------------  state                       HEALTHY last-unhealthy             2025-01-01 18:00:10 unhealthy-count          1

REST API

GET https://<ip>/nvue_v1/system/health/component

nv action clear system health component

Clear system components unhealthy information.

Syntax Description

N/A

Default

N/A

History

25.02.7002

Example

Copy
Copied!
            

admin@nvos:~$ nv action clear system health component   Action executing ... Cleared unhealthy information successfully Action succeeded

REST API

POST https://<ip>/nvue_v1/system/health/component

Related Commands

Notes

The clear command resets only the last‑unhealthy and unhealthy‑count fields. The state field is not reset.
